- What is Globe Life's ann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net?
- Globe Life (GL) reported ann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net of $5.72M in Q3 2024.
- How has Globe Life's ann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net changed year-over-year?
- Globe Life's ann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net decreased by 16.6% year-over-year, from $6.85M to $5.72M.
- What is the long-term trend for Globe Life's ann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net?
- Over 2 years (2021 to 2023), Globe Life's ann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net has grown at a -10.5%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$34.98M to $28.04M.
- What does ann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net mean?
- The net cost of paying out benefits and claims to annuity policyholders.
- How do you interpret ann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net?
- A decrease relative to revenue is generally positive, indicating favorable claims experience or improved underwriting, while an increase may signal higher-than-expected benefit payouts.
- How does annuity — policyholder benefits and claims incurred, net compare across companies?
- Standard metric across the insurance industry, often labeled as 'Benefits and Claims' or 'Policyholder Benefits'.
